Understanding Your 2016 F150 Power Inverter Wiring Diagram

The 2016 F150 Power Inverter Wiring Diagram serves as a visual blueprint detailing the electrical connections and pathways related to your truck's integrated power inverter. This system allows you to convert your truck's 12-volt DC power into standard household 110-volt AC power, enabling you to run various electronic devices directly from your vehicle. This is incredibly useful for a wide range of applications, from charging laptops and power tools at a job site to running small appliances during a camping trip.

Here's a breakdown of what you might find within the diagram:

  1. Power Source: Traces the path of 12V DC power from the battery to the inverter.
  2. Inverter Unit: Shows the internal connections and specifications of the inverter itself.
  3. Output Receptacle(s): Details how the converted AC power is delivered to the outlets in your truck.
  4. Protection Components: Highlights the fuses and circuit breakers designed to protect the system.
The diagram will typically show wire colors, connector types, and fuse ratings, which are all vital pieces of information for anyone working with the system. For example, you might see a table like this outlining key components:
Component Fuse Rating Wire Gauge (Typical)
Main Inverter Circuit 30 Amp 10 AWG
Accessory Output 15 Amp 14 AWG
This table is a simplified representation, but it illustrates the kind of detail you can expect to find.
